Walter was born to a Jewish family in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. He was the only son along with seven sisters. The family later moved to Long Island, New York.
When Walter’s father died in 1942, Walter took control of a failing media business that included radio, TV and print media.
Walter proved to be an exceptional businessman and added additional media companies to his existing collection. Then in 1952 Walter saw a newspaper ad for a local weekly magazine called “TV Digest” and had an idea.
Intrigued by the ad, Walter decided to launch a national magazine dedicated to TV programming. He named it “TV Guide”. Every financial advisor he consulted told him the magazine was a big mistake.
The first issue in 1953 focused on the most popular show on television, “I Love Lucy”, and featured Lucille Ball on the cover with stories about her, her husband Desi Arnez and their new baby. The public loved it, and it sold in huge numbers.
But sales quickly dropped and as Walter re-examined his marketing strategy, he realized that the magazine could only succeed if it met people’s needs.
Walter did new research to find what people wanted and based on the results, did two things. He first added regional editions to provide local information, but his big change was to start a fall edition that would feature information on all the new shows being introduced. This is what the people wanted, and TV Guide became a national phenomenon.
Walter created a profitable success because he met the needs of others. Later when Walter Annenberg became the United States Ambassador to the United Kingdom, he was still known as the man who started “TV Guide”.
